Kate Pieratt: Abstract This study looks at how Berea College, a small liberal arts college at the foothills of the Appalachian Mountains in eastern Kentucky, is contributing to the shrinkage of brain drain, or the mass migration of the workforce from the Appalachian Mountain region to larger cities and metropolitan areas in search of greater economic opportunities, through the programming efforts of the Loyal Jones Appalachian Center. Berea has dedicated much of its efforts to admitting underprivileged mountain youth through the concept of sponsored mobility. Cultural heritage and pride in institutional identity is also a focal point of Berea’s mission. Concluding remarks include suggestions for improvement of the Appalachian Center’s success at promoting cultural diversity awareness.
